About Organisation

The Asia-Pacific Society for Computers in Education (APSCE) was established on January 1, 2004, as an independent academic society. Its primary mission is to encourage scientific research and the dissemination of knowledge about the use of computers in education. APSCE focuses on enhancing educational practices through technology, particularly in the Asia-Pacific region. It aims to bridge the gap between research and practice, promoting international collaboration among educators, researchers, and policymakers to advance educational technology. The society supports the development and application of computer-based tools in learning environments, fostering innovation and research in areas such as artificial intelligence, digital infrastructure, and mobile learning technologies. APSCE’s broad initiatives aim to shape the future of education, ensuring that technology remains a critical tool for global learning advancement.

About the Grant

The 33rd International Conference on Computers in Education (ICCE 2025) is organized by APSCE and will be hosted by the Indian Institute of Technology Madras (IITM). This conference, scheduled from December 1 to 5, 2025, will offer a platform for researchers, educators, and policymakers to connect and share insights about the role of computers in education. It will be a meta-conference comprising seven specialized sub-conferences, focusing on various aspects of technology-enhanced learning, including artificial intelligence, educational gamification, learning analytics, and more. Accepted papers in the conference will be published in proceedings and submitted to Elsevier for inclusion in Scopus. Notably, distinguished papers will have the opportunity for publication in the official academic journal of APSCE, Research and Practice in Technology Enhanced Learning. This event provides an excellent opportunity for global dissemination and collaboration on research related to educational technology.

Who can Apply?

ICCE 2025 welcomes participants from diverse backgrounds, including researchers, graduate and undergraduate students, policymakers, and educators. Applicants are encouraged to submit their papers based on the themes outlined in the sub-conferences, which include areas such as Artificial Intelligence in Education, Educational Gamification, and Technology Enhanced Language Learning. Authors must adhere to the submission guidelines, which vary depending on the paper category: full papers (8-10 pages), short papers (5-6 pages), or poster papers (2-3 pages). The conference is particularly open to those with a strong interest or ongoing research in the application of computers in education. Submissions that focus on innovative technologies or methodologies for learning and teaching are highly encouraged. Authors of accepted papers will have the chance to present their research and contribute to the broader academic community. Eligibility is based on the research topic alignment with the themes of the conference and the quality of the submission.
